Output ad103a35186af7e92960c70170befbf311034ac3c10319f652cddc3c6753c07b:6

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 952416bee0c77aa9e9faadaa552721dd4ea62ac4 OP_EQUALVERIFY OP_CHECKSIG
address
1Ebav5e6umCXiDWCcKyNuF8LS4FZ57yJcS
transaction
ad103a35186af7e92960c70170befbf311034ac3c10319f652cddc3c6753c07b
spent
true